Three-year analysis of zirconia implants used for single-tooth replacement and three-unit fixed dental prostheses: A prospective multicenter study

Clinical Oral Implants Research Apr 20, 2018

Balmer M, et al. - Experts assessed clinically and radiographically the outcome of zirconia oral implants after 3 years in function. They used a linear mixed model to evaluate statistically the influence of prognostic factors on changes in the marginal bone level. High survival rate and a low marginal bone loss were demonstrated by the investigated one-piece zirconia implant after 3 years in function. For single-tooth replacement and 3-unit fixed dental prosthesis (FDP), the implant system was seen to be successful.
